/// Converts a std.math.CompareOperator into a condition flag,
/// i.e. returns the condition that is true iff the result of the
/// comparison is true. Assumes signed comparison
pub fn fromCompareOperatorSigned(op: std.math.CompareOperator) Condition {
return switch (op) {
.gte => .ge,
.gt => .gt,
.neq => .ne,
.lt => .lt,
.lte => .le,
.eq => .eq,
};
}
/// Converts a std.math.CompareOperator into a condition flag,
/// i.e. returns the condition that is true iff the result of the
/// comparison is true. Assumes unsigned comparison
pub fn fromCompareOperatorUnsigned(op: std.math.CompareOperator) Condition {
return switch (op) {
.gte => .cs,
.gt => .hi,
.neq => .ne,
.lt => .cc,
.lte => .ls,
.eq => .eq,
};
}
/// Returns the condition which is true iff the given condition is
/// false (if such a condition exists)
pub fn negate(cond: Condition) Condition {
return switch (cond) {
.eq => .ne,
.ne => .eq,
.cs => .cc,
.cc => .cs,
.mi => .pl,
.pl => .mi,
.vs => .vc,
.vc => .vs,
.hi => .ls,
.ls => .hi,
.ge => .lt,
.lt => .ge,
.gt => .le,
.le => .gt,
.al => unreachable,
};
}
};
